What is the best grade of stainless steel flatware?

The best grade of stainless steel flatware is often considered to be 18/10 stainless steel. This designation refers to the composition of the steel, with 18% chromium and 10% nickel. Chromium provides corrosion resistance and durability, while nickel adds shine and enhances corrosion resistance even further. 18/10 stainless steel flatware is highly resistant to rust, tarnish, and staining, making it ideal for everyday use as well as special occasions. Its durability and luster make it a popular choice for high-end flatware.

Which is better, 18/8 or 18-10 stainless steel?

When comparing 18/8 and 18/10 stainless steel, 18/10 is generally considered superior. Both types contain 18% chromium, but the difference lies in the nickel content: 18/8 contains 8% nickel, while 18/10 contains 10%. The additional nickel in 18/10 stainless steel provides better corrosion resistance and a brighter, more lustrous finish. While 18/8 is still a good option and offers decent durability and resistance to corrosion, 18/10's higher nickel content gives it an edge in terms of both performance and appearance.

What is good quality stainless steel cutlery?

Good quality stainless steel cutlery typically features a high chromium and nickel content, such as 18/10 stainless steel. This composition ensures excellent resistance to rust and corrosion, a high level of durability, and a polished, shiny finish that enhances the table setting. Additionally, good quality cutlery should have a solid, well-balanced feel in the hand and a smooth, seamless construction to prevent food particles from getting trapped. Brands like Oneida, Zwilling J.A. Henckels, and Lenox are known for producing high-quality stainless steel cutlery.

What is the healthiest stainless steel flatware?

The healthiest stainless steel flatware is typically made from high-grade stainless steel such as 18/10 or medical-grade 316 stainless steel. These types of stainless steel are non-reactive, meaning they do not leach harmful chemicals into food, making them safe for long-term use. They are also resistant to corrosion, which helps prevent any potential buildup of harmful bacteria. For those with sensitivities or allergies, medical-grade 316 stainless steel may be preferred due to its even higher resistance to corrosion and chemical leaching.

Is 18-8 or 316 stainless better?

When comparing 18/8 stainless steel to 316 stainless steel, 316 is generally considered better, especially for applications requiring superior corrosion resistance. 316 stainless steel, also known as marine-grade stainless steel, contains 16-18% chromium, 10-14% nickel, and 2-3% molybdenum. The addition of molybdenum significantly enhances its resistance to pitting and corrosion, especially in chloride environments like saltwater. While 18/8 stainless steel is sufficient for most household uses, 316 stainless steel is preferred in more demanding environments where higher durability and resistance to chemicals are required.
